Two-Dimensional Polyacrylamide Gel Electrophoresis of Human Serum: A Case Report of Suspected Chemical Agent Exposure

摘要

Serum was obtained from a patient who was suspected of having been exposed to mustard agent, Cl(CH2)2S(CH2)2Cl. Samples were collected approximately 30 days after the incident and were subjected to two-dimensional polyacrylamide gel electrophoresis. Serum proteins thus separated were then stained consecutively with Coomassie blue and silver. Compared to a sample of normal serum, no fewer than 5 of the patient's serum proteins displayed differences in isoelectric point as determined by the isoelectric focusing step. Most of these modifications were manifested as basic shifts. These shifts could possibly be attributed to mustard agent exposure since, among its many other effects, mustard agent is expected to esterify aspartic acid and glutamic acid residues. The differences seen between the patient's serum and the normal volunteer's, however, could have arisen due to numerous other factors. Thus, without knowing in advance what mustard agent does to human serum proteins, the results do not prove that the patient was exposed to mustard agent. This case highlights the need for us to define the effects of mustard and other chemical agents on serum proteins so as to develop a diagnostic tool for firmly establishing whether or not a given casualty has been exposed to a chemical agent such as mustard.
